Re: Bind9 im chroot loggt trotz vorhandenem Log-Socket nicht

From: Bjoern Engels <bengels(at)lanworks.de>
Date: Wed, 6 Nov 2002 13:19:43 +0100

Am Mittwoch, 6. November 2002 09:57 schrieb Bernd Walter:

> > ich habe hier einen Bind9 laufen, der einfach nicht loggen will -
> > außer dem eigentlichen Start taucht nichts in /var/log/messages
> > auf.
> >
> > Bind läuft chrooted unter /var/namedb:
> > /usr/local/sbin/named -u bind -t /var/namedb -c named.conf
> >
> > Der Syslogd hat einen zusätzlichen Log-Socket bekommen:
> > /usr/sbin/syslogd -ss -l /var/namedb/var/run/log
> >
> > Dieser ist auch korrekt angelegt worden. Warum taucht nun nichts in
> > den Logfiles auf?
>
> Du kannst den Syslogd im Debug Mode starten.
> Er sagt dann im Detail was reinkommt und was er gedenkt damit zu tun.
> Im Jail kannst du nun mit logger Einträge zum syslogd schicken
> erzeugen.

Tja, ich sehe jetzt zwar, daß beim syslogd etwas ankommt, in der Datei
tut sich aber trotzdem nichts. Folgendes schnappt syslogd auf:

# /usr/sbin/syslogd -ss -l /var/namedb/var/run/log -d
can't open /dev/klog (2)
off & running....
init
cfline("*.err;kern.debug;auth.notice;mail.crit /dev/console",
f, "*", "*")
cfline("*.notice;kern.debug;lpr.info;mail.crit;news.err
/var/log/messages", f, "*", "*")
cfline("security.*
/var/log/security", f, "*", "*")
cfline("mail.info
/var/log/maillog", f, "*", "*")
cfline("lpr.info
/var/log/lpd-errs", f, "*", "*")
syslogd: /var/log/lpd-errs: No such file or directory
logmsg: pri 53, flags 4, from news, msg syslogd: /var/log/lpd-errs: No
such file or directory
Logging to CONSOLE /dev/console
cfline("cron.* /var/log/cron",f, "*", "*")
cfline("*.err root", f, "*", "*")
cfline("*.notice;news.err root", f, "*", "*")
cfline("*.alert root", f, "*", "*")
cfline("*.emerg *", f, "*", "*")
cfline("*.* /var/log/slip.log", f, "startslip", "*")
cfline("*.* /var/log/ppp.log", f, "ppp", "*")
7 3 2 3 5 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 X FILE: /dev/console
7 5 2 5 5 5 6 3 5 5 5 5 5 5 5 5 5 5 5 5 5 5 5 5 X FILE:/var/log/messages
X X X X X X X X X X X X X 8 X X X X X X X X X X X FILE:/var/log/security
X X 6 X X X X X X X X X X X X X X X X X X X X X X FILE: /var/log/maillog
X X X X X X 6 X X X X X X X X X X X X X X X X X X UNUSED:
X X X X X X X X X 8 X X X X X X X X X X X X X X X FILE: /var/log/cron
3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 3 X USERS: root,
5 5 5 5 5 5 5 3 5 5 5 5 5 5 5 5 5 5 5 5 5 5 5 5 X USERS: root,
1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 X USERS: root,
0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 X WALL:
8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 X FILE:/var/log/slip.log
(startslip)
8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 8 X FILE: /var/log/ppp.log
(ppp)
logmsg: pri 56, flags 4, from news, msg syslogd: restart
syslogd: restarted
logmsg: pri 36, flags 0, from news, msg Nov 6 10:29:11 named[57247]:
client 192.168.101.30#1366: query: stderr.mydailyoffers.com IN MX
logmsg: pri 36, flags 0, from news, msg Nov 6 10:29:16 named[57247]:
client 192.168.101.30#1368: query: stdin-bs-01.mydailyoffers.com IN
AAAA
logmsg: pri 36, flags 0, from news, msg Nov 6 10:29:21 named[57247]:
client 192.168.101.30#1370: query: stdin-bs-01.mydailyoffers.com IN A
logmsg: pri 36, flags 0, from news, msg Nov 6 10:29:23 named[57247]:
client 192.168.101.30#1371: query: 69.113.9.217.in-addr.arpa IN PTR

Und so weiter ... Im chroot habe ich folgende Dateien / Devices
angelegt:

# ls -alR [dev]*
dev:
total 4
drwxr-xr-x 2 root wheel 512 Nov 6 08:46 ./
drwxr-xr-x 8 root wheel 512 Nov 6 08:49 ../
lrwxr-xr-x 1 root wheel 14 Nov 6 08:46 log@ -> ../var/run/log
crw-r--r-- 1 root wheel 2, 3 Nov 6 08:45 random
crw-r--r-- 1 root wheel 2, 12 Nov 6 08:44 zero

etc:
total 6
drwxr-xr-x 2 root wheel 512 Nov 6 08:45 ./
drwxr-xr-x 8 root wheel 512 Nov 6 08:49 ../
-rw-r--r-- 1 root wheel 837 Nov 6 08:45 localtime

var:
total 6
drwxr-xr-x 3 root wheel 512 Jul 1 16:36 ./
drwxr-xr-x 8 root wheel 512 Nov 6 08:49 ../
drwxr-xr-x 2 bind wheel 512 Nov 6 10:30 run/

var/run:
total 6
drwxr-xr-x 2 bind wheel 512 Nov 6 10:30 ./
drwxr-xr-x 3 root wheel 512 Jul 1 16:36 ../
srw-rw-rw- 1 root wheel 0 Nov 6 10:30 log=
-rw-r--r-- 1 bind wheel 6 Nov 6 10:29 named.pid

Fehlt da noch etwas ?

Gruß

Björn

-- 
"The number of Unix installations has grown to ten, with more expected"
                                 [ The Unix programmers manual, 1972 ]
To Unsubscribe: send mail to majordomo(at)de.FreeBSD.org
with "unsubscribe de-bsd-questions" in the body of the message
Received on Wed 06 Nov 2002 - 13:20:46 CET

search this site